Step-by-step explanation:

LOCATION

Arab: an ethnic group whose ancestry originated on the Arabian Peninsula. This ethnic group dominates the Middle East and North Africa

Persian: the dominant ethnic group of Iran and Western Afghanistan

Kurds: this ethnic group has no permanent homeland of their own. This group is based in the mountain area betwen Turkey, Syria, Iraq, and Iran

LANGUAGE

Arabic: the language that most Arabs speak

Persian and Pashto: Kurdish language is comprised of these two languages

Farsi: the language spoken by Persians

RELIGION

Islam: the spread of this particular religion caused the Arabs to expand off of the Arabian Peninsula

Shia Islam: 90% of Iran and 60% of Iraq belongs to this branch of Islam

Sunni Islam: the branch of Islam that Arabs and Kurds practice
